Title: Analysis of Adrenergic Receptors during the Onset and Progression of Metabolic Syndrome

Abstract: Male C57BL/6J mice fed with high fat simple carbohydrate (HFSC) diet were used as the newlinemodel to study the adrenergic receptors (AR) during the onset and development of metabolic newlinesyndrome (MetS). A detailed profiling of ARs in the brainstem, hypothalamus and pancreas newlinewas undertaken using radioreceptor assays, gene expression studies, cAMP analysis and p- newlineCREB analysis. A preliminary study was also undertaken to assess the effect of sympathetic newlineactivation in the liver and kidney of this model. Also, the role of ARs in leptin secretion from newlineadipose tissue explants was studied using an in vitro approach. newlineA reduction in the density of ARs along with altered affinity of and#945; and and#946; ARs was observed in newlinethe brainstem of HFSC fed mice. Gene expression studies revealed that the adrenergic newlinereceptor genes were upregulated in the brainstem of HFSC fed mice. However, there was no newlinesignificant change in the cAMP content. It was observed that Adra1a, Adra1b, Adra1d, newlineAdra2a, Adra2b, Adra2c and Adrb1 genes were downregulated and Adrb2 gene was newlineupregulated in the hypothalamus of HFSC fed mice. The analysis of cAMP content did not newlineshow any significant change. However, increased expression of p-CREB was observed in the newlinehypothalamus of HFSC fed mice. The gene expression study of whole pancreas of HFSC fed newlinemice showed downregulation of Adra1a, Adra1d, Adra2b, Adra2c and Adrb1 genes along newlinewith upregulation of Adra2a and Adrb3 genes. This was accompanied by low cAMP levels newlineand p-CREB expression. newlineHistopathological analysis of the liver of HFSC fed mice showed signs of non alcoholic fatty newlineliver disease (NAFLD), whereas that of the kidney of HFSC fed mice did not show any newlinecharacteristic feature of chronic kidney disease associated with MetS. Further, analysis of newlineurinary total protein did not show any significant levels of protein.
